Subject: [igt-dev] [PATCH i-g-t] tests/i915/gem_exec_capture: Adding Local memory support
Date: Thu, 24 Feb 2022 10:50:02 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220224052002.11852-1-sai.gowtham.ch@intel.com> (raw)

From: Ch Sai Gowtham <sai.gowtham.ch@intel.com>

Adding local memory support to many-4K-zero subtest

Signed-off-by: Ch Sai Gowtham <sai.gowtham.ch@intel.com>
Cc: Zbigniew Kempczyński <zbigniew.kempczynski@intel.com>
---
 tests/i915/gem_exec_capture.c | 36 +++++++++++++++++++++--------------
 1 file changed, 22 insertions(+), 14 deletions(-)

diff --git a/tests/i915/gem_exec_capture.c b/tests/i915/gem_exec_capture.c
index 60f8df04..3eb516e7 100644
--- a/tests/i915/gem_exec_capture.c
+++ b/tests/i915/gem_exec_capture.c
@@ -415,7 +415,7 @@ static struct offset *
 __captureN(int fd, int dir, uint64_t ahnd, const intel_ctx_t *ctx,
 	   const struct intel_execution_engine2 *e,
 	   unsigned int size, int count,
-	   unsigned int flags, int *_fence_out)
+	   unsigned int flags, int *_fence_out, uint32_t region)
 #define INCREMENTAL 0x1
 #define ASYNC 0x2
 {
@@ -436,7 +436,7 @@ __captureN(int fd, int dir, uint64_t ahnd, const intel_ctx_t *ctx,
 	obj = calloc(count + 2, sizeof(*obj));
 	igt_assert(obj);
 
-	obj[0].handle = gem_create(fd, 4096);
+	obj[0].handle = gem_create_in_memory_regions(fd, 4096, region);
 	obj[0].offset = get_offset(ahnd, obj[0].handle, 4096, 0);
 	obj[0].flags = EXEC_OBJECT_WRITE | (ahnd ? EXEC_OBJECT_PINNED : 0);
 
@@ -459,7 +459,7 @@ __captureN(int fd, int dir, uint64_t ahnd, const intel_ctx_t *ctx,
 		}
 	}
 
-	obj[count + 1].handle = gem_create(fd, 4096);
+	obj[count + 1].handle = gem_create_in_memory_regions(fd, 4096, region);
 	obj[count + 1].relocs_ptr = (uintptr_t)reloc;
 	obj[count + 1].relocation_count = !ahnd ? ARRAY_SIZE(reloc) : 0;
 	obj[count + 1].offset = get_offset(ahnd, obj[count + 1].handle, 4096, 0);
@@ -585,7 +585,7 @@ __captureN(int fd, int dir, uint64_t ahnd, const intel_ctx_t *ctx,
 		saved = configure_hangs(fd, e, ctx->id); \
 	} while(0)
 
-static void many(int fd, int dir, uint64_t size, unsigned int flags)
+static void many(int fd, int dir, uint64_t size, unsigned int flags, uint32_t region)
 {
 	const struct intel_execution_engine2 *e;
 	const intel_ctx_t *ctx;
@@ -607,7 +607,7 @@ static void many(int fd, int dir, uint64_t size, unsigned int flags)
 	intel_require_memory(count, size, CHECK_RAM);
 	ahnd = get_reloc_ahnd(fd, ctx->id);
 
-	offsets = __captureN(fd, dir, ahnd, ctx, e, size, count, flags, NULL);
+	offsets = __captureN(fd, dir, ahnd, ctx, e, size, count, flags, NULL, region);
 
 	blobs = check_error_state(dir, offsets, count, size, !!(flags & INCREMENTAL));
 	igt_info("Captured %lu %"PRId64"-blobs out of a total of %lu\n",
@@ -620,7 +620,7 @@ static void many(int fd, int dir, uint64_t size, unsigned int flags)
 }
 
 static void prioinv(int fd, int dir, const intel_ctx_t *ctx,
-		    const struct intel_execution_engine2 *e)
+		    const struct intel_execution_engine2 *e, uint32_t region)
 {
 	const uint32_t bbe = MI_BATCH_BUFFER_END;
 	struct drm_i915_gem_exec_object2 obj = {
@@ -677,7 +677,7 @@ static void prioinv(int fd, int dir, const intel_ctx_t *ctx,
 		/* Reopen the allocator in the new process. */
 		ahnd = get_reloc_ahnd(fd, ctx2->id);
 
-		free(__captureN(fd, dir, ahnd, ctx2, e, size, count, ASYNC, &fence_out));
+		free(__captureN(fd, dir, ahnd, ctx2, e, size, count, ASYNC, &fence_out, region));
 		put_ahnd(ahnd);
 
 		write(link[1], &fd, sizeof(fd)); /* wake the parent up */
@@ -767,6 +767,7 @@ igt_main
 	struct igt_collection *regions, *set;
 	char *sub_name;
 	uint32_t region;
+	uint32_t system_region = INTEL_MEMORY_REGION_ID(I915_SYSTEM_MEMORY, 0);
 
 	igt_fixture {
 		int gen;
@@ -803,29 +804,36 @@ igt_main
 		}
 	}
 
-	igt_subtest_f("many-4K-zero") {
+
+	igt_subtest_with_dynamic("many-4K-zero") {
 		igt_require(gem_can_store_dword(fd, 0));
-		many(fd, dir, 1<<12, 0);
+		for_each_combination(regions, 1, set) {
+			sub_name = memregion_dynamic_subtest_name(regions);
+			region = igt_collection_get_value(regions, 0);
+			igt_dynamic_f("%s", sub_name)
+				many(fd, dir, 1<<12, 0, region);
+			free(sub_name);
+		}
 	}
 
 	igt_subtest_f("many-4K-incremental") {
 		igt_require(gem_can_store_dword(fd, 0));
-		many(fd, dir, 1<<12, INCREMENTAL);
+		many(fd, dir, 1<<12, INCREMENTAL, system_region);
 	}
 
 	igt_subtest_f("many-2M-zero") {
 		igt_require(gem_can_store_dword(fd, 0));
-		many(fd, dir, 2<<20, 0);
+		many(fd, dir, 2<<20, 0, system_region);
 	}
 
 	igt_subtest_f("many-2M-incremental") {
 		igt_require(gem_can_store_dword(fd, 0));
-		many(fd, dir, 2<<20, INCREMENTAL);
+		many(fd, dir, 2<<20, INCREMENTAL, system_region);
 	}
 
 	igt_subtest_f("many-256M-incremental") {
 		igt_require(gem_can_store_dword(fd, 0));
-		many(fd, dir, 256<<20, INCREMENTAL);
+		many(fd, dir, 256<<20, INCREMENTAL, system_region);
 	}
 
 	/* And check we can read from different types of objects */
@@ -837,7 +845,7 @@ igt_main
 
 	test_each_engine("pi", fd, ctx, e)
 		igt_dynamic_f("%s", (e)->name)
-			prioinv(fd, dir, ctx, e);
+			prioinv(fd, dir, ctx, e, system_region);
 
 	igt_fixture {
 		close(dir);
